Ira Nääppä

Ira brings design-thinking into city innovation. As a designer, she believes design isn’t just about how things look – it’s a powerful tool for creating systematic, collaborative and meaningful societal impact. At Demos Helsinki, Ira is the one to approach for creative problem-solving, systems thinking, empathy-driven methods, making abstract ideas visually tangible, and future-oriented design approaches that turn good intentions into real societal transformation.

She holds a Bachelor’s degree in Design from LAB Institute of Design, specializing in service design. In her bachelor’s thesis, Ira explored how design activism can spark cross-sector collaboration and strengthen democracy in urban design. Before joining Demos Helsinki, she worked in the public sector in city planning, coordinating co-design processes and vision work in zoning projects to bring residents’ insights into planning decisions. Along the way, she has contributed to urban greening initiatives, innovation projects, and user experience research.
